Crime overview

Joans Walk area has the 27th highest crime rate of 78 local areas in Hoyland Milton , and the 328th highest crime rate of 845 local areas in Barnsley .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Joans Walk (S74 0JB) in the last 12 months was 96.7 per 1,000 residents and was 7.8% higher than the Hoyland Milton average (89.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 19 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 200.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

Violent crimes totalled 20 (≈ 50.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 11.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-61.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Joans Walk (S74 0JB), the main crime hotspot is near Wentworth Road. Police recorded 27 crimes here, including 16 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
